Škoda Peaq vs Tesla Model Y
Biggest differences: Power — Škoda Peaq 286 PS, Tesla Model Y 514 PS · 0–100 km/h — Škoda Peaq 7.1 s, Tesla Model Y 4.8 s · DC charging — Škoda Peaq 199 kW, Tesla Model Y 250 kW.
Škoda Peaq
The Škoda Peaq is an electric SUV in the D segment, offering three drive variants with ranges reaching up to 647 km according to the WLTP standard.
Tesla Model Y
The Tesla Model Y is an electric SUV in the D segment, offering three different drive configurations with varying ranges and acceleration performance.

Technical data: Škoda Peaq vs Tesla Model Y
Bold and underline = better value · ↓ = lower is better · — = no data
| Key parameters | Škoda Peaq90 | Tesla Model YPremium AWD |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Range and energy | |||
| WLTP range | 647 km | 622 km | Škoda +25 km |
| Battery | 86 kWh | 79 kWh | Škoda +7 kWh |
| Consumption ↓ | 15 kWh/100 km | 15.6 kWh/100 km | Škoda −0.6 kWh/100 km |
| Charging | |||
| DC charging | 199 kW | 250 kW | Tesla +51 kW |
| AC charging | 11 kW | 11 kW | No difference |
| Charging 10–80% ↓ | 28 min | — | — |
| Range per minute of charging | 16.2 km/min | — | — |
| Voltage | 400 V | 400 V | No difference |
| Performance and drivetrain | |||
| Power | 286 PS | 514 PS | Tesla +228 PS |
| 0–100 km/h ↓ | 7.1 s | 4.8 s | Tesla −2.3 s |
| Top speed | 180 km/h | 201 km/h | Tesla +21 km/h |
| Drivetrain | RWD | AWD | different type |
| Practicality | |||
| Weight ↓ | 2234 kg | 1997 kg | Tesla −237 kg |
| Boot | 935 l | 822 l | Škoda +113 l |
| V2L (external power) | Yes | No | only Škoda |
| Length | 4874 mm | 4790 mm | Škoda +84 mm |
| Width | 1867 mm | 1920 mm | Tesla +53 mm |
| Height | 1664 mm | 1624 mm | Škoda +40 mm |
| Wheelbase | 2965 mm | 2890 mm | Škoda +75 mm |
The better value in each row is bold and underlined in the colour of the car. Metrics marked ↓ — lower is better. Dimensions are shown without picking a winner.

Frequently asked questions about this comparison
Which has the longer range — Škoda Peaq or Tesla Model Y?
The Škoda Peaq goes further: 647 km WLTP against the 622 km of the Tesla Model Y. That is a difference of 25 km.
How do the drivetrains of the Škoda Peaq and the Tesla Model Y differ?
The Škoda Peaq has RWD and 286 PS. The Tesla Model Y has AWD and 514 PS.
Which one can power appliances from a socket (V2L)?
Only the Škoda Peaq — its 86 kWh battery then works as a power source. The Tesla Model Y, with 79 kWh, does not offer it.
Which is more powerful — Škoda Peaq or Tesla Model Y?
The Tesla Model Y is stronger: 514 PS against the 286 PS of the Škoda Peaq. The gap is 228 PS.

Range, consumption and weight are given for the base configuration: manufacturers homologate them as a band of values that depends on wheels and equipment (e.g. 533–592 km), and we take the lightest variant, on the smallest wheels — i.e. the most favourable. The same model on larger wheels will travel a shorter distance.
